#706922 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#706922 is composed of 43.9% red, 41.2% green and 13.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 6.3% magenta, 69.6% yellow and 56.1% black. It has a hue angle of 54.6 degrees, a saturation of 53.4% and a lightness of 28.6%. #706922 color hex could be obtained by blending #e0d244 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

Shades and Tints of #706922
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070602 is the darkest color, while #fcfcf7 is the lightest one.
